How they compare
Denmark currently reports 1.08 against 0.88 in Netherlands, a difference of 0.2.
That makes Denmark's figure about 1.2 times Netherlands's.
Across all 31 years both countries report, Denmark has been ahead every year.
Denmark ranks 26th and Netherlands ranks 27th of 27 countries.
Denmark has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Denmark | Netherlands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 3.04 | 0.4275 | 2.61 | Denmark |
| 2000s | 3.08 | 0.353 | 2.73 | Denmark |
| 2010s | 0.921 | 0.355 | 0.566 | Denmark |
| 2020s | 1.19 | 0.6457 | 0.5429 | Denmark |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
